The purpose of the research: to find an adequate mathematical description of the process with the aim of effective influence on its kinetic parameters, which will ensure obtaining a material with the desired electrophysical properties. Research methods and equipment: performing experimental studies, analysis of scientific and technical and patent literature, use of topokinetic analysis. It has been proved that the topokinetic analysis of the process of carbothermal self-recovery of dispersed samples "Wustite-graphite" can be applied to the process of iron oxide reduction using the Avrami-Yerofeev equation in combination with the Sharpe-Hancock procedure. The calculated imaginary activation energy of this process, Ea, is equal to 141.34 kJ/mol. and it is shown that the process is limited by the carbon gasification reaction. The object of the research in the second section is the process of processing steel in the intermediate ladle of the MBRZ with powder-coated wire with a modifier. The purpose of the study is to find the optimal technological parameters of the effect of the modifier on the quality of low-carbon steel and to determine the optimal way of introducing powder-coated wire into the intermediate ladle, which will ensure a high level of calcium assimilation. The introduction of the modifier in the form of SiCa powder wire should be considered optimal. The presence of a steel shell in which the modifier is located creates conditions under which Ca is released from this shell after its complete melting in the lower horizons of the metal melt. Having a low melting and boiling temperature, as well as a much lower specific gravity compared to the metal melt, calcium undergoes the following stages of interaction with it: liquid state - the boiling state of the modifier - the state of transformation of Ca into steam.
